程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
您现在的位置: 程式師世界 >> 編程語言 >  >> 更多編程語言 >> Python

Python join() 方法

編輯:Python

文章目錄

  • join() 方法簡介
    • join() 方法的語法格式如下:
    • 【例 1】將列表中的字符串合並成一個字符串。
    • 【例 2】將元組中的字符串合並成一個字符串。


join() 方法簡介

join() 方法也是非常重要的字符串方法,它是 split() 方法的逆方法,用來將列表(或元組)中包含的多個字符串連接成一個字符串。

想詳細了解 split() 方法的讀者,可閱讀《Python split()方法》一節。
使用 join() 方法合並字符串時,它會將列表(或元組)中多個字符串采用固定的分隔符連接在一起。例如,字符串“c.biancheng.net”就可以看做是通過分隔符“.”將 [‘c’,‘biancheng’,‘net’] 列表合並為一個字符串的結果。

join() 方法的語法格式如下:

newstr = str.join(iterable)

此方法中各參數的含義如下:

  • newstr:表示合並後生成的新字符串;
  • str:用於指定合並時的分隔符;
  • iterable:做合並操作的源字符串數據,允許以列表、元組等形式提供。

【例 1】將列表中的字符串合並成一個字符串。

>>> list = ['c','biancheng','net']
>>> '.'.join(list)
'c.biancheng.net'

【例 2】將元組中的字符串合並成一個字符串。

>>> dir = '','usr','bin','env'
>>> type(dir)
<class 'tuple'>
>>> '/'.join(dir)
'/usr/bin/env'

  1. 上一篇文章:
  2. 下一篇文章:
Copyright © 程式師世界 All Rights Reserved